The removal of nitrogen oxides (NOx) from stationary or mobile
sources has become an important issue.
For the reduction of the NOx emission, selective catalytic reduction and
three waty catalyst technology offers the best choice for combining low emission
values; high removal efficiencies; and long-term, cost effective compliance. SCR
system can be classified into three categories according to the nature of
reductant and applications. Our group is mainly interested in the overall SCR
and TWC system including the preparation of optimized catalytic materials,
characterization of prepared catalyst, investigation of reaction mechanism,
reaction kinetics and modeling of TWC process. Specific research areas in PECL
(Postech
Environmental Catalysis Laboratory) are followings
